Key Aspects of PCR Machine Repair Service in Malawi
- Diagnostics and Troubleshooting: Identifying the root cause of malfunctions, which could range from heating/cooling element failures, optical system issues, lid clamp malfunctions, power supply problems, or software glitches.
- Component Replacement: Sourcing and replacing faulty parts, such as Peltier modules, sensors, power boards, optical components (e.g., LEDs, detectors), and touch screens.
- Calibration and Performance Verification: Ensuring the machine's thermal accuracy and uniformity meet manufacturer specifications through rigorous calibration procedures and performance tests.
- Preventive Maintenance: Scheduled servicing to clean components, check for wear and tear, update firmware, and lubricate moving parts, thereby minimizing the likelihood of unexpected breakdowns.
- Software Updates and Troubleshooting: Addressing software errors, driver issues, or user interface problems that may impede operation.
- On-site and Off-site Support: Offering repair services at the client's location or at a dedicated service center, depending on the complexity of the issue and logistical considerations.
- Training and User Support: Providing guidance to laboratory personnel on basic maintenance and proper operation to extend instrument lifespan and reduce service calls.

Pcr Machine Repair Service Cost In Malawi
PCR (Polymerase Chain Reaction) machines are vital diagnostic tools in laboratories across Malawi, used for a wide range of applications including disease detection, research, and quality control. Like any sophisticated electronic equipment, PCR machines require regular maintenance and occasional repairs. The cost of PCR machine repair services in Malawi can vary significantly depending on several factors, making it important for users to understand these influences to budget effectively. These costs are typically discussed and quoted in the local currency, the Malawian Kwacha (MWK).
| Repair Type/Service | Estimated Cost Range (MWK) | Notes |
|---|---|---|
| Routine Maintenance/Servicing | 150,000 - 400,000 MWK | Includes cleaning, calibration, basic checks. Essential for longevity. |
| Minor Component Repair (e.g., fan, sensor) | 200,000 - 700,000 MWK | Cost depends on the specific part and labor. |
| Major Component Replacement (e.g., thermal cycler, power supply, motherboard) | 800,000 - 3,500,000+ MWK | Can be very expensive, especially for specialized parts. May approach the cost of a new unit for older machines. |
| Software/Firmware Issues | 100,000 - 500,000 MWK | Includes troubleshooting and reinstallation. |
| On-site Diagnostic Visit & Quote | 50,000 - 150,000 MWK | Often includes a basic assessment. May be waived if repair is approved. |
| Emergency/Expedited Repair | Additional 30% - 70% on top of standard repair cost | For urgent situations, subject to technician availability. |
Key Pricing Factors for PCR Machine Repair in Malawi:
- Type and Model of PCR Machine: Different PCR machines have varying levels of complexity, age, and brand reputation. High-end, newer models with advanced features or specialized components will generally command higher repair costs compared to older or simpler machines.
- Nature and Severity of the Fault: Minor issues, such as a malfunctioning fan or a loose connection, will be less expensive to fix than major component failures like a damaged thermal cycler block, a faulty power supply, or a corrupted control board.
- Availability of Spare Parts: The cost of replacement parts is a significant factor. If a specific part is rare, imported, or out of production, its price will be higher. Local availability of genuine or compatible parts can influence repair costs.
- Technician Expertise and Experience: Highly skilled and experienced technicians, particularly those with specialized training for specific PCR machine brands, may charge more for their services. However, their expertise often leads to more efficient and reliable repairs.
- Urgency of Repair: Emergency or same-day repair services typically incur higher fees than scheduled maintenance or repairs that can be addressed during regular business hours.
- Location of Service: If the repair requires the technician to travel to a remote location within Malawi, travel expenses (transportation, accommodation if necessary) will be added to the overall cost.
- Diagnostic Fees: Many repair services include a diagnostic fee to identify the problem. This fee is often waived or deducted from the total repair cost if the customer proceeds with the repair.
- Warranty Status: If the PCR machine is still under warranty, the repair might be covered. However, out-of-warranty repairs will be fully chargeable.
- Service Provider: Different repair companies or individual technicians will have their own pricing structures, overheads, and profit margins, leading to variations in quotes.

Scope Of Work For Pcr Machine Repair Service
This Scope of Work (SOW) outlines the required services for the repair of a Polymerase Chain Reaction (PCR) machine. The objective is to restore the PCR machine to its full operational capacity, ensuring accurate and reliable performance for biological research and diagnostic applications. This document details the technical deliverables, standard specifications, and acceptance criteria for the repair service.
| Specification | Requirement | Verification Method | Acceptance Criteria |
|---|---|---|---|
| Temperature Accuracy | ± 0.2°C within the specified range (e.g., 4°C to 99.9°C) | Independent temperature validation using calibrated probes (e.g., NIST-traceable) | Measured accuracy within ± 0.2°C for all tested points. |
| Temperature Uniformity | ± 0.3°C across the block within the specified range | Temperature mapping across all block positions using calibrated probes | Maximum deviation across all wells is less than or equal to 0.3°C. |
| Heating/Cooling Rate | As per manufacturer specifications (e.g., 3-5°C/sec) | Time-based measurement of temperature changes between set points | Achieves specified heating/cooling rates within ± 10%. |
| Lid Temperature Control | Maintains specified heated lid temperature (e.g., 105°C ± 2°C) | Direct measurement of lid temperature using calibrated probe | Lid temperature consistently within ± 2°C of the set point. |
| Block Integrity | No physical damage or corrosion affecting performance | Visual inspection and functional testing | Block is free from visible damage, and sample wells accommodate standard consumables. |
| Optical System (if applicable) | Consistent signal detection across all channels, within manufacturer specifications | Fluorescence signal measurements using standard controls or dyes | Signal-to-noise ratio meets or exceeds manufacturer baseline; no cross-channel contamination. |
| User Interface/Software | Fully functional and responsive touchscreen or control panel | Interactive testing of all menu options and programming functions | All functions operate correctly, and software is stable. |
| Power Supply and Connectivity | Stable power input and all external connections (USB, Ethernet, etc.) are functional | Electrical testing and connection verification | Machine powers on consistently; all ports are recognized and functional. |
